A Module Temperature Sensor is a sensing device consisting of components that are installed directly in a single module in battery cells, power modules, semiconductor boards, solar panels, industrial generators, or control units. They measure the real-time temperature accurately at the place where heat is generated.
The sensors are found in different types like
• NTC thermistors known for their quick response and high sensitivity.
•RTD sensors are known for their higher accuracy and long- lasting stability. They help to provide efficient work with less complexity.
The sensor designs are embedded into PCB-based sensors, it offers flexible installation and better integration with nodes of electronics.

A Module temperature sensor is used to measure the temperature of a machine. It is also used in renewable energy setups to monitor and maintain safe operating conditions.
Solar panels - For PV solar controllers, the temperature sensor is used to monitor and control the temperature of the device. This helps prevent overheating and ensures smooth operation.
Electric vehicles - In electric vehicles, temperature sensors protect the batteries from overheating and prevent sudden failure. This helps improve battery life and vehicle safety
Hospital Equipment- Temperature sensors are used in medical equipment to maintain safety while operating and monitoring patients. The efficiency and accuracy of hospital equipment are very important, and proper temperature measurement ensures this.
Data Centers- In data centers, devices keep running for long hours. Temperature sensors protect the equipment by controlling heat levels and preventing overheating, which ensures continuous and safe working.
Smartphones and Laptops- Temperature sensors are used in smartphones, laptops, and other electronic appliances to increase their life and durability. They help maintain safe temperatures during heavy usage.
For selecting the right modular temperature sensor, you must check various parameters as per your working efficiency and choose the one which fits your requirement.
Temperature Measuring Range:
Range: –40°C to 125°C (Low to Medium)
Up to 300°C or more (High Temperature)
Choose the one that matches your requirement and the temperature your application can produce.
Accuracy Rate of Measuring Temperature:Accuracy depends on the device in which the sensor is used.
Simple Devices: ±1°C to ±2°C
EV Battery & Solar Inverter: ±0.5°C to ±1°C
Big Industrial Setup: ±0.1°C to ±0.2°C
Time of the Temperature Sensor: When temperature increases or decreases, the sensor must respond quickly so it can protect the system from overheating.
Measure Temperature: Ensure the sensor measures the actual temperature of the device and not the surrounding environment.
